Ángel Nevado is a scholar working on Cognitive Neuroscience, Psychiatry and Mental health and Cellular and Molecular Neuroscience. According to data from OpenAlex, Ángel Nevado has authored 25 papers receiving a total of 632 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Cognitive Neuroscience, 7 papers in Psychiatry and Mental health and 4 papers in Cellular and Molecular Neuroscience. Recurrent topics in Ángel Nevado's work include Functional Brain Connectivity Studies (14 papers), Neural dynamics and brain function (13 papers) and Visual perception and processing mechanisms (7 papers). Ángel Nevado is often cited by papers focused on Functional Brain Connectivity Studies (14 papers), Neural dynamics and brain function (13 papers) and Visual perception and processing mechanisms (7 papers). Ángel Nevado collaborates with scholars based in Spain, United Kingdom and Netherlands. Ángel Nevado's co-authors include Fernando Maestú, Francisco del Pozo, Ricardo Bajo, Nazareth P. Castellanos, Malcolm P. Young, Manuel López‐Martín, Belén Carro, Stefano Panzeri, R. G. H. Robertson and Kun Guo and has published in prestigious journals such as PLoS ONE, NeuroImage and Neuroscience.
